All About 'Nonvital': Meaning, Strategy & Finding Words From Letters
Meaning:
The term nonvital refers to something that is not essential or crucial for survival or functioning. It is commonly used in various contexts, particularly in medicine and biology, to describe processes, organs, or functions that do not directly contribute to life-sustaining activities. In the realm of word games like Scrabble, nonvital is recognized in standard Scrabble dictionaries, making it a valid choice for players.
About the Word:
Usage of the word nonvital can often be found in discussions regarding health, where it distinguishes between essential and non-essential aspects of the body or systems. The prefix "non-" indicates negation, while "vital" comes from the Latin vitalis, meaning "of life." This combination of letters provides opportunities for players to explore creative combinations when searching for words from letters.
Etymology:
The word nonvital is formed by the prefix "non-" meaning "not," and the root "vital," which derives from the Latin vitalis. This linguistic evolution reflects the word's function of negating the significance of something that is otherwise deemed vital. Its construction showcases the flexibility of the English language in forming new meanings through prefixes.
Fun Facts / Trivia:
One interesting linguistic feature of nonvital is its use as a compound word, combining a prefix with a root to create a clear negation of meaning. Additionally, the term is frequently employed in medical contexts, such as "nonvital organs," which indicates organs that can be removed or are not critical to life.
